Do you know what makes a good news story?
Can you think of a single major brand that doesn’t use PR in its armoury?
Communication is changing and PR specialists have led the way in communicating with the media. But no matter what size your business is or what industry you are in, there are some key considerations when it comes to dealing with the media.
This event will cover some important specifics including
- Who to deal with in the media
- How to build relationships with key media
- What makes a news story
- How to write exciting, news-worthy copy
Our expert speaker is Nicky Rudd, MD of Padua Communications.
